The U.S. budget deficit for the first five months of fiscal 2025 hit a record of $1.147 trillion. This included a $307 billion February deficit for President Donald Trump's first full month in office, up 4% from a year earlier. Though the fiscal year is not yet at the halfway point, the budget shortfall for February 2025 has already passed the $1 trillion mark. This has raised concerns about the country's financial future.
Government spending eased slightly on a monthly basis, still, it far outpaced revenue, according to a Treasury Department statement. The deficit is $318 billion higher than in the same period last year.

Budget Deficit Keeps Growing
Net costs to finance the $36.2 trillion national debt edged lower to $74 billion for the month. However, the total net interest payments year to date rose to $396 billion. This amount is now just behind the country's expenditures on defence and health care.
President Donald Trump has made getting the government’s fiscal house in order a priority since taking office. Since taking over, he has created the so-called Department of Government Efficiency, to be led by Elon Musk.

The advisory board has led job reductions across various departments, alongside offering early retirement incentives. A Treasury spokesperson stated that the DOGE initiatives have not yet shown any clear effects but deferred further inquiries to the Musk-led panel. Meanwhile, Trump is advocating for an extension of the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act, a key policy from his first term. However, several think tanks claim that renewing the act could increase the deficit by $3.3 trillion over the next decade.
